IND vs ENG 4th Test: India won in Ranchi Test, Rohit and Gill scored half-centuries

Indian team won the 17th consecutive series in its host country by defeating England by five wickets.

Proving once again its supremacy on its soil, the Indian team won the 17th consecutive series in its host country by defeating England by five wickets on the fourth day in the fourth cricket test. Chasing the target of 192 runs to win, India started the game ahead of yesterday’s score of 40 runs without any loss.

Opener Yashasvi Jaiswal (37 runs in 44 balls) and captain Rohit Sharma (55 runs in 81 balls) added 84 runs for the first wicket. After the fall of both their wickets, Rajat Patidar and Ravindra Jadeja were also out cheaply but Shubman Gill (52 not out) and Dhruv Jurel (39 not out) made a partnership of 72 runs to take the team to victory.
